Get started for FREE Continue. Prezi. Web5 mei 2024 · Cane toads were introduced to Australia in 1935 to control agricultural pests. They proved ineffective in this role, but adapted well to the Australian environment and spread quickly. They are now found in Queensland, New South Wales, the Northern Territory and Western Australia.

WebStory of the Cane Toad – Biological Control Gone BAD! Cane toads were introduced to Australia in 1935 as a biological control method against the Greyback beetle that was destroying sugar cane crops. The Cane toad is native to South and Central America and had been used successfully as a biological control agent against beetles in Hawaii. The Cane Toad for example is considered an invasive species due to its rapid growth in areas in has been introduced to. The toad is a prolific breeder, has very few predators, and has a wide range in diet making it easy for them to survive in many conditions. nagoya-gym shinko-sports.com
